We installed cabinets for a much needed island but didn't want to try to match countertops with what we had. We decided to give concrete a try. It was a lot of trial and error, this was the fourth attempt before I felt like I got it right. I filled in all the air holes with a slurry mix, let it cure, sanded it, and repeated three times. Finally we stained it with malasian buff and coffee acid stain from directcolors.com then applied a Rust-Oleum gloss sealer. We are very satisfied with the results, I almost gave up on it but happy I didn't.
